Isomerization studies: II. Thermal alteration of oleic acid and methyl oleate in the presence of mineral catalysts
Authors:A Eisner  P A Barr  T A Foglia
Affiliation:1. Eastern Regional Research Center, 19118, Philadelphia, Pennsylvania
Abstract:A structure analysis has been conducted on the distillable fraction (67–71%) obtained from the clay catalyzed isomerization of methyl oleate and oleic acid. The method of analysis involved the combined use of reductive ozonolysis, urea adduction, and gas liquid chromatography-mass spectrometry. The results of this study indicate that the original unsaturation of the fatty acid is mostly retained, but less than the theoretical amount of hydrogen is absorbed when the products are subjected to low pressure catalytic hydrogenation. These results in conjunction with the gas liquid chromatography-mass spectrometry data suggest that branching of the carbon chain has occurred.
